Hair Transplant Scalp Care: Dos and Don’ts After Surgery

After a hair transplant, your scalp is in a delicate state and requires gentle handling. The first few days are crucial for healing, so avoid touching or scratching the transplanted area. Keep your head elevated while sleeping to reduce swelling. Your surgeon may provide a saline spray to keep the grafts hydrated—use it as instructed.

Activities to Avoid:

To protect the newly implanted grafts, avoid strenuous activities such as heavy exercise, swimming, or excessive sweating for at least two weeks. Exposure to direct sunlight should also be minimized, as UV rays can damage the healing scalp. Wearing a loose-fitting hat when outdoors can help provide protection.

Managing Itching and Scabbing:

Mild itching and scabbing are common as the scalp heals. Do not pick at scabs, as this can dislodge the grafts and cause infections. If the itching becomes uncomfortable, a prescribed moisturizing spray or lotion may help soothe the area. Keeping your scalp hydrated is key to a smooth healing process.

Avoiding Harmful Products:

Stay away from hair styling products, such as gels, sprays, and dyes, for at least a month after surgery. These products contain chemicals that can irritate the scalp and affect graft survival. Also, avoid using harsh shampoos or conditioners that contain sulfates and parabens.

Diet and Hydration for Recovery:

Proper nutrition plays a role in healing and hair growth. Stay hydrated and consume a balanced diet rich in proteins, vitamins, and minerals. Foods high in vitamin C, iron, and biotin can support hair health. Avoid alcohol and smoking, as they can slow down the recovery process.

Long-Term Care for Healthy Hair Growth:

Once the initial healing phase is over, focus on maintaining scalp health with a gentle hair care routine. Regularly wash your scalp with mild shampoo, avoid excessive heat styling, and massage the scalp gently to improve blood circulation. Patience is key, as new hair growth may take several months to become noticeable.
